Why Urinary Tract Health is Crucial for Cats

Adorable grey cat near litter box indoors. Pet care

Urinary tract health is critical for cats. Poor urinary health can result in recurrent issues and complications, such as urethral obstructions, which are severe and require urgent veterinary attention. These obstructions can be life-threatening, so prioritizing urinary tract support for pets is crucial for cat’s healthy urinary tract owners.

Adequate hydration is key to a healthy urinary tract in cats. It aids in waste elimination and reduces the risk of infections. Cats often prefer fresh, flowing water, making it important to provide clean water sources. Monitoring your cat’s drinking habits and urine output helps ensure proper hydration, with healthy cats typically producing clear to pale yellow urine.

Diet and supplements also play a role in maintaining a healthy urine pH, essential for urinary tract health. Cranberries, with their antioxidant properties, may boost the immune system in cats, combating various health issues. A powerful and healthy balance of a balanced diet and access to clean water significantly promote urinary tract health.

How to Choose the Right Urinary Tract Supplement

Selecting the right urinary tract supplement for your cat can be challenging but is vital for their health. Consider the specific urinary health issue your cat has, as different formulations target various conditions. Consult with your veterinarian, especially if your cat has kidney disease, since some supplements may lower urine pH and be harmful.

Researching the active ingredients in the supplement is crucial. Look for scientifically-supported ingredients like D-Mannose, which promotes proper urinary tract function. Ensure these ingredients align with the product’s claims regarding urinary health support.

Lastly, verify that the product is suitable for long-term use and has positive reviews from other cat owners. Combining veterinarian advice, active ingredient research, and user feedback will help you choose an effective urinary tract support supplement for your cat.

Benefits of Natural Ingredients in Urinary Tract Supplements

Natural ingredients in urinary tract supplements offer numerous benefits for your cat’s urinary health. Cranberries, for example, help balance urine pH and may reduce the formation of crystals in the urinary tract. They are rich in antioxidants, particularly proanthocyanins, which prevent bacteria from adhering to the urinary tract walls.

Marshmallow root is beneficial for its soothing properties that alleviate discomfort from urinary issues. Echinacea enhances the immune response, combating urinary infections and promoting overall bladder health.

D-Mannose, found in some urinary tract supplements, prevents bacteria from sticking to the bladder lining, supporting healthy urinary tract function.
